[C#] 프로그래밍 기초 : 가비지 컬렉터
안녕하세요! 이번에는 C#에서의 가비지 컬렉터에 대해 자세히 알아보겠습니다. 가비지 컬렉터는 C#에서 메모리 관리를 자동으로 처리하는 기능입니다. 이를 통해 개발자는 메모리 할당과 해제를 직접 다룰 필요 없이 안정적인 프로그램을 작성할 수 있습니다. 가비지 컬렉터의 작동 원리 C#에서는 가비지 컬렉터가 자동으로 더 이상 사용되지 않는 객체를 감지하고 메모리를 해제합니다. 가비지 컬렉터는 주기적으로 실행되며, 다음과 같은 원리로 작동합니다. 객체의 생성 C#에서는 new 연산자를 사용하여 객체를 생성합니다. 생성된 객체는 힙(heap) 영역에 할당됩니다. 객체의 접근 가능성 생성된 객체는 다른 변수나 참조를 통해 접근 가능한 상태입니다. 다른 변수나 참조가 해당 객체를 참조하고 있다면, 해당 객체는 접근 ..